4/16/2017
Freedom Factory
Bad day turns into a great day for Davis at Desoto
Bad day turns into a great day for Davis at Desoto By SCOTT LOCKWOOD Desoto Speedway Dave Davis had to call in a favor to a fellow racer on Saturday after his car suffered a radiator failure during p...